It’s Not Too Late to Earn a CSI Certification

Now is the time to unlock your potential and advance your career goals.

Earning a recognized credential validates your expertise and shows you have the skills to make an impact. Choose from four specialized programs:

Construction Documents Technologist (CDT)

Proves your know-how about the project delivery process, team roles and tasks, and effective documentation.

Certified Construction Specifier (CCS)

Validates you’re a product researcher who knows how to investigate and identify cost-effective, efficient solutions, and then communicate those solutions through the specifications.

Certified Construction Contract Administrator (CCCA)

Confirms your skills in creating, managing, and applying construction documents through the project lifecycle.

Certified Construction Product Representative (CCPR)

Shows your ability to inform decision-makers and present the right product or material based on a project across all phases of the delivery process.

Four Industry Leaders Join CSI Fellowship

CSI is excited to announce the 2025 Class of CSI Fellows.

Fellows are selected by their peers based on their achievements in the industry and above-and-beyond contributions to CSI at the national, regional, and chapter levels. The distinction of Fellow is one of the highest honors given to a CSI member. Here are the four new Fellows:

  • Arthur “Cam” Featherstonhaugh IV, FCSI, Lifetime Member
  • Charles Hendricks, FCSI, CDT
  • Tom Lanzelotti, FCSI, CDT
  • Randall Lewis, FCSI
